GE Shipping to Acquire Two New Tankers

Great Eastern Shipping Company Ltd. has ordered two new building Long Range One (LR1) Product tankers from STX Shipbuilding Company Ltd., Korea. Great Eastern said the vessels, of around 74,500 dwt each, are due for delivery during the third quarter of 2008-09. With this order, the company's new building order book stands at nine tankers (4 LR1 product tankers and 5 MR product tankers) with an aggregate dwt of 0.52 million and 5 OSVs (4 AHTSVs and 1 PSV). The existing fleet of 74 vessels of the company includes 40 ships with an average age of 12.7 years and 34 offshore units and the order book comprises 12 vessels — seven tankers and five offshore supply vessels (OSVs). GE Shipping Acquires OSV

According to source, the Great Eastern Shipping Company on Monday took delivery of a newly built OSV named `Malaviya Twenty Five' from Bharati Shipyard Ltd. With this, the company's fleet now stands at 73 vessels - 40 ships and 33 offshore assets. The company has also signed a new building contract with Bharati Shipyard Ltd for a 140 T bollard pull anchor handling tug supply vessel with delivery expected by mid-2007. Apart from these, a modern Aframax crude carrier is due to join the company's fleet this month, the company said in a release. The company has also signed a contract with STX Shipbuilding Company Ltd, Korea for construction of 2 Long Range One (LR1) Product Tankers of 74,500 dwt each. source: Sify
